Myth #1: Online Casinos Are Rigged
This is probably the most pervasive myth, and it’s understandable why it exists. The fear is that the games are somehow programmed to cheat players. However, reputable online casinos are heavily regulated by independent bodies like the Malta Gaming Authority, the UK Gambling Commission, or the Irish Revenue Commissioners (for those operating within Ireland). These regulators ensure that the games use Random Number Generators (RNGs). RNGs are complex algorithms that generate completely random outcomes, guaranteeing fairness. Furthermore, these casinos are regularly audited by independent testing agencies, such as eCOGRA, to verify the fairness of their games. So, while it’s true that some less reputable sites might be out there, sticking to licensed and regulated casinos is the key to ensuring fair play.
Understanding RNGs
Think of an RNG as a digital dice roller. Each time you spin a slot reel or play a hand of cards, the RNG generates a random number that determines the outcome. This process is completely automated and unbiased, making it impossible for the casino to predict or manipulate the results. The house edge still exists, of course (that’s how casinos make money), but the outcomes themselves are random.
Myth #2: You Can Predict the Outcome of Games
This is a tempting one, especially for games like slots and roulette. Many players believe they can spot patterns or use «systems» to predict when a win is coming. Unfortunately, the randomness of the RNG makes this impossible. Each spin of the reels or spin of the roulette wheel is independent of the last. Past results have absolutely no bearing on future outcomes. While some strategies can improve your odds in games like blackjack or poker (where skill plays a significant role), they won’t work in games based purely on chance.
The Gambler’s Fallacy
This myth is closely related to the idea of predicting outcomes. The Gambler’s Fallacy is the belief that if something happens more frequently than normal during a given period, it will happen less frequently in the future, or vice versa. For example, if red has come up on the roulette wheel several times in a row, a player might believe that black is «due» to come up. However, the wheel has no memory, and each spin is a fresh start.
Myth #3: Online Casinos Don’t Pay Out
Again, this myth stems from a lack of understanding and, sometimes, experiences with less-than-reputable sites. Licensed and regulated online casinos are legally obligated to pay out winnings to players. The payout process is usually straightforward, involving verification of your identity and the method of payment you choose. Delays can sometimes occur, but these are usually due to security checks or the processing times of the payment provider, not a refusal to pay. Always check the casino’s terms and conditions regarding withdrawals before you play.
Choosing a Reputable Casino
The best way to avoid payout problems is to play at a reputable casino. Look for casinos that are licensed by respected regulatory bodies, have positive reviews from other players, and offer a variety of secure payment methods.
Myth #4: All Casino Bonuses Are a Free Lunch
Casino bonuses can be a great way to boost your bankroll, but it’s essential to understand that they’re not free money. Most bonuses come with wagering requirements, which mean you need to wager a certain amount of money before you can withdraw your winnings. Read the terms and conditions carefully before accepting any bonus. Pay close attention to the wagering requirements, the games that contribute towards those requirements, and the time limits for fulfilling the requirements. Some bonuses might seem attractive on the surface but are actually difficult to clear.
Understanding Wagering Requirements
Wagering requirements are typically expressed as a multiple of the bonus amount (e.g., 30x the bonus). This means you need to wager 30 times the bonus amount before you can withdraw any winnings. For example, if you receive a €100 bonus with a 30x wagering requirement, you’ll need to wager €3,000 before you can cash out.
Myth #5: You Can’t Win Big Online
This is simply untrue. Online casinos offer the same opportunities to win big as their land-based counterparts, and sometimes even more. Many online casinos offer progressive jackpots that can reach staggering amounts. These jackpots grow with each bet placed on the participating games, and they can be won randomly or by triggering a specific bonus feature. Furthermore, the payout percentages (RTP – Return to Player) of online slots are often higher than those of land-based slots, giving you a slightly better chance of winning.
Progressive Jackpots
Progressive jackpots are linked to a network of games, and a portion of each bet contributes to the jackpot pool. The jackpot continues to grow until a lucky player wins it. These jackpots can reach millions of euros, offering the potential for life-changing wins.
